Why did the Turks want to take constantinople?​

Respuesta :

mcdonbra1
mcdonbra1 mcdonbra1
  • 23-02-2021

Answer:

The Ottoman Turks were determined to capture Constantinople. Their nickname for it was the ‘Golden Apple’, the ultimate prize. Like New York, the ‘Big Apple’ of our times, Constantinople, the Golden Apple, was seen at the time as the ultimate metropolis, the ultimate object of desire.
